Abstract

The utility model relates to a paint baking room with an electrical protection function. The paint baking room comprises a heating box and a chamber, wherein a combustion chamber is arranged in the heating box; a combustor is arranged in the combustion chamber; an air inlet, a circulating fan and an air outlet pipe are arranged on the heating box; a hot air filter is arranged in the middle of the heating box; a circulating fan pressure difference sensor is arranged at the position of the circulating fan on the heating box; a filter pressure difference sensor for monitoring the difference of pressure on two sides of the filter is arranged at the position of the hot air filter on the heating box; a heating box temperature sensor is arranged in the heating box; a paint baking chamber temperature sensor is arranged in the paint baking chamber; a combustible air detection sensor is also arranged in the paint baking chamber; signal output ends of the sensors are electrically connected to a controller; and the controller controls starting and stopping of the circulating fan and the combustor. By the paint baking room, a wind pressure monitoring function of the circulating fan, functions of monitoring combustible air in the paint baking chamber and giving an alarm and a high-temperature alarming function are realized; and the whole paint baking room is simple in structure, convenient to operate and control, and safe and reliable.

Background technology
Traditional combined padding and drying system includes baking vanish chamber and the heating cabinet that is interconnected.Be provided with the combustion chamber in the heating cabinet; Install combustion device in the combustion chamber; Heating cabinet one end is provided with another opposite end of air intlet and is provided with circulating fan and escape pipe, and the combustion chamber is to the air heat in the heating cabinet, after the air after the heating passes the screen pack that is horizontally set with in heating cabinet; It is indoor finally to provide power to be sent to baking vanish through escape pipe by circulating fan; End near the air inlet pipe of heating cabinet also is provided with the return duct that is communicated with the baking vanish chamber, flow back into through this return duct at the indoor hot-air after heat exchange of baking vanish again and continues heating in the heating cabinet, forms a hydronic air circulation system.
Electic protection for combined padding and drying system; Only circulating fan and burner are carried out manual order start and stop in the prior art,, temperature long-time superelevation etc. unusual for the blower fan belt that possibly occur has the situation of damage not have corresponding mechanism for monitoring and counter-measure to equipment; In addition, the volatile matter benzene during paint drying, xylenes etc. belong to inflammable and explosive substances, if can not in time detect, very easily cause serious consequences such as combined padding and drying system blast.
